‘I feel stronger’: Jane Fonda optimistic about her chances of recovering from cancer

The Oscar-winning actress, who suffers from cancer of the lymphatic system, gives news of her state of health.

American actress and activist Jane Fonda, who announced last Friday that she had cancer, broke the news this week on her blog, saying she was “very well.”

“This is not my first encounter with cancer,” the star wrote. “I had breast cancer and a mastectomy before. It went very well and I will do very well again.” And to add:

“So many people have written to tell me they had the same cancer and had been cured for decades. I’ll be 85 soon. I don’t have to worry about living another decade. I’d settle for just one.”

“Three weeks after my first chemotherapy session, I must say that I feel stronger than I have in many years,” he wrote, adding that he was doing a lot of sports exercises and that he walks every day from morning to dawn.

The Oscar-winning actress suffers from non-Hodgkin’s lymphoma, a cancer of the lymphatic system. She said that she was optimistic about her chances of recovery, denouncing in the process the inequalities of access to care in the United States.

“I’m also lucky to have health insurance and access to the best doctors and treatment. I know I’m privileged and that’s sad,” she said last week.
